Behnam, Ken;
Wind speed units are in km/d in all DSSAT potential ET models.

Behnam,

What version of DSSAT are you using?  We don't recommend Penman-24 any more in the current version as it is too ET-demanding (not correct).  The FAO-56 was added (configured) after about 2004, as FAO (1998 publications) decided that ET was not as high as originally proposed.  I thought DSSAT was using correct units for both (km/day).  So I have three questions:

1)  Cheryl Porter, would you investigate the units for windrun per day in both FAO-56 and Penman-24 (old non-recommended)?

2)  Behnam, tell me what version of DSSAT you are using?  What crop?  If it is maize and you have drought, the "old" model prior to 2012 had a CO2 sensitive aspect of ET on canopy resistance that may cause under-prediction of transpiration under drought when LAI was low.  That could be part of the issue, that you wanted really high ET (for arid desert environment) and the FAO-56 coupled with this feature on the maize model could have been giving you less ET than you wanted.   So it may not be an error in the windspeed units.

We don't use relative humidity in the ET computations in DSSAT.  We use dewpoint temperature.  If you want it, you will need to compute it as you did.

TAVE is the season-long mean air temperature (average of monthly Tmean, from (monthly Tmax+Tmin)/2).

TAMP is the difference (range) from the highest monthly mean air temperature to the lowest monthly mean air temperature.

TAVE and TAMP can be computed from the climate "file" that Weatherman creates for each weather site, but it IS NOT AUTOMATICALLY OUTPUT to the weather file.  Hence your problem and problem for others.

These two parameters are used in the soil temperature prediction, and affect the maize crop phenology until the 5-leaf stage.  So it is very important that you (and everyone else) does not ignore this.  In absence of values (-99 default), the model has default of 20.0 TAVE and xxxx (I don't know) TAMP.

Dear Users,

I was using WeatherMan for creating the weather data files for DSSAT. But,
some issues brought some questions up  for me:



1) WeatherMan uses the unit KM/day (=M/Sec*86.4) for wind speed. In this
case, when I use Penmann24 method for ET calculation, the simulation results
seem ok. But, when I use FAO56, the yields become near zero. When I changed
the values of wind speed into M/Sec, the results seemed more acceptable and
very similar to Penmann24. What is the correct unit for Wind?

2) Why WeatherMan doesn't export Relative Humidity data into DSSAT weather
files? I had to write an algorithm in MATLAB to create DSSAT weather files
for all weather variables.

3) What are the exact meaning of TAV and AMP in weather data files? Is these
correct:

                TAV : Mean value for Average Temperature through the whole
data series.

                AMP : ?
